Vertical Development: Transforming Your Leadership Operating System

Leadership Circle Profile

Get to Know Us

Here's where real transformation happens.

Vertical development isn't about learning new skills—it's about fundamentally changing how you see yourself, your team, and your role as a leader.

Based on research by Bob Anderson and Robert Kegan, leaders operate from one of two internal systems:

Reactive Leadership (Where Most Leaders Get Stuck)

What It Looks Like:

Controlling: You feel responsible for every outcome, so you micromanage, check every detail, and struggle to delegate because "it's faster to do it myself."

Protecting: You defend your decisions, avoid vulnerability, keep your guard up, and see challenges as threats to your competence or position.

Complying: You focus on meeting others' expectations, pleasing stakeholders, avoiding conflict, and maintaining harmony even when bold action is needed.

Why It Happens: These patterns developed because they worked when you were earlier in your career. Controlling got results. Protecting kept you safe. Complying helped you advance.

The Problem: What worked as a manager creates a ceiling as a leader.

Creative Leadership (Where Executives Operate)

What It Looks Like:

Relating: You build authentic connections, foster collaboration, develop people, and create environments where teams thrive together.

Self-Aware: You understand your impact, seek feedback openly, acknowledge your limitations, and lead from authenticity rather than proving yourself.

Achieving: You inspire others to execute your vision, create alignment around goals, and drive results through people rather than despite them.

Purposeful & Visionary: You see the bigger picture, articulate compelling direction, make strategic decisions, and lead with clarity about where you're taking the organization.

Systems Thinker: You understand interconnections, anticipate downstream effects, navigate complexity, and lead beyond your direct control.

Why It Works: Creative leaders inspire movements. People want to follow them. Teams execute their vision without constant oversight. They shape culture, not just manage tasks.

Skills without mindset transformation: You learn delegation techniques but still micromanage under pressure. You know you should empower people but revert to control when stakes are high

.

Mindset transformation without skills: You shift how you think but lack the practical tools to translate that into action. You want to inspire but don't know how to communicate vision effectively.

Vertical + Horizontal together: You transform who you are as a leader AND build the capabilities to execute from that new operating system. The shift sticks because it's supported by both consciousness and competency.
